Skyridge Neighborhood Overview

Overview

Skyridge is a well-established residential neighborhood located in the northeastern quadrant of Lebanon, Georgia, nestled within Cherokee County. The community is positioned conveniently off East Cherokee Drive (Highway 5), offering a quiet, suburban setting with relatively easy access to the commercial corridors of Canton and the expansive natural beauty of Lake Allatoona. Developed primarily in the 1990s and early 2000s, Skyridge represents a period of steady growth for Lebanon, providing a blend of spacious lots and family-oriented living.

The character of Skyridge is defined by its rolling topography, mature tree canopy, and a strong sense of privacy. Homes are situated on generously sized lots, many backing to wooded areas, creating a serene atmosphere that feels removed from the bustle despite its proximity to essential amenities. The neighborhood’s layout, with its curvilinear streets and cul-de-sacs, fosters a safe environment for children and promotes a close-knit community feel among its residents.

Housing & Real Estate

The housing stock in Skyridge consists predominantly of traditional single-family homes, with architectural styles ranging from classic brick-front Colonials and sprawling Ranch-style homes to two-story transitional designs. Sizes typically range from 2,000 to over 3,500 square feet, with many homes featuring finished basements, large decks, and multi-car garages. The mature landscaping and established neighborhoods contribute significantly to the area's curb appeal and desirability.

Price ranges in Skyridge are reflective of its established nature and lot sizes, generally sitting in the mid to upper price tier for the Lebanon area. Recent trends show a stable market with steady appreciation, attracting buyers seeking more space and a settled community compared to newer, denser subdivisions. The neighborhood is overwhelmingly owner-occupied, with a very low rental presence, which reinforces its stable, long-term residential character.

Schools & Education

Families in Skyridge are served by the highly regarded Cherokee County School District. The neighborhood is typically zoned for Avery Elementary School, Teasley Middle School, and Sequoyah High School. These schools are known for their strong academic programs, extracurricular offerings, and active parental involvement, making the area particularly attractive to families with school-aged children.

In addition to the public school system, residents have access to several private educational options within a reasonable drive, including Cherokee Christian School and various preschools and daycare centers in the Canton area. The proximity to Sequoyah High School, a comprehensive school with a wide array of Advanced Placement courses and competitive athletic teams, is a significant draw for the community.

Parks & Recreation

While Skyridge itself is a residential community without a dedicated homeowners' association pool or clubhouse, it is surrounded by exceptional public recreational facilities. The expansive Blankets Creek Mountain Bike Trail System, part of the Cherokee County Recreation and Parks Agency, is just minutes away and offers world-class mountain biking and hiking trails for all skill levels, drawing outdoor enthusiasts from across the region.

Residents also enjoy quick access to the shores of Lake Allatoona, with marinas like Little River Marina providing opportunities for boating, fishing, and watersports. For more traditional park amenities, the nearby Cherokee County Aquatic Center, Hobgood Park with its extensive sports fields, and the serene grounds of the Cherokee Arts Center offer diverse options for fitness, sports, and cultural activities for all ages.
